Red chili - top it with cilantro, shredded cheddar, tortilla chips, or sliced onions and jalapenos. Verde - top it with lime wedges, sour cream, cilantro, crushed chips, chopped green onions. White - top it with jalapeno slices, avocado, chopped tomatoes, crumbled bacon, hot sauce, chips.

Other Dish Ideas. In addition to the chili and its accompanying toppings, bringing a side dish or two is always appreciated at a chili potluck. Some popular side dish options to consider are a fresh green salad, a hearty mac and cheese, or a warm and comforting corn casserole.

Cook the chili ahead. The longer it simmers and sits overnight, the better the flavors. Bake the cornbread. Cut into large chunks. Create the board with a space in the center to add the hot pot of chili (lay down a hot pad). When ready, reheat the chili in a shallow pan to add to the board when hot.

Instructions. Poke several holes in the potatoes on all sides. Rub potatoes with olive oil on a baking pan. Sprinkle sea salt over the potatoes liberally. Bake in a 425°F oven for 55-60 minutes. Serve with butter, sour cream, chives, cheese, and bacon bits.
